The street in brief

Top Green is almost entirely det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£470,000 — roughly 18% above the SO51 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; SO51 prices as a whole have been easing. HM Land Registry records 11 sales across 9 homes since 2002 — homes here come up rarely.

Top Green's £470,000 median sits about 18% above SO51's £397,500.

Street and SO51 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
